Description

The Ibanez SRG450QMZD Standard is a standout in the world of solid body electric guitars, offering a harmonious blend of style and substance for musicians of all levels. Crafted with precision by Ibanez, this guitar is designed to deliver powerful sound and exceptional playability. It features a quilted maple top that not only enhances the aesthetic appeal but also contributes to the guitar's tonal clarity and resonance. The SRG450QMZD is equipped with a set of specially designed pickups, providing a versatile tonal range that covers everything from warm, rich lows to bright, cutting highs.

The neck is constructed using a combination of maple and walnut, offering strength and stability, while the rosewood fingerboard ensures smooth playability. The slim neck profile is ideal for fast playing techniques, making it a favorite among shredders and soloists. Additionally, the guitar boasts a double-locking tremolo system, allowing for expressive pitch modulation with reliable tuning stability.

Whether you're performing on stage or practicing at home, the Ibanez SRG450QMZD Standard promises to be a reliable companion, supporting your musical journey with its robust construction and versatile sound palette.

Product specs

Brand Ibanez
Model SRG450QMZD-AMB Standard, SRG450QMZD-BB Standard, SRG450QMZD-LC Standard, SRG450QMZD-TGB Standard, SRG450QMZD-TLB Standard
Year 2012
Made In Indonesia
Categories Solid Body Electric Guitars
Body Material Basswood
Body Shape S-Style
Body Type Solid Body
Bridge/Tailpiece Type Locking Tremolo Bridge
Color Family Grey, Pink, Purple, Red
Finish Features Matching Headstock
Finish Pattern Sunburst
Finish Style Gloss
Fretboard Material Rosewood
Model Family Ibanez RG
Neck Construction Bolt-On
Neck Material Maple
Number of Frets 24
Number of Strings 6-String
Pickup Configuration HSH
Right / Left Handed Right Handed
Scale Length 25.5"
Series Ibanez Standard
Top Material Maple
Wood Top Style Quilted

FAQs

What type of pickups does the Ibanez SRG450QMZD Standard have?

The Ibanez SRG450QMZD Standard features an HSH pickup configuration, which includes two humbuckers and a single-coil pickup, providing a versatile range of tones suitable for various music genres.

Is the Ibanez SRG450QMZD Standard suitable for heavy metal music?

Yes, the Ibanez SRG450QMZD Standard is well-suited for heavy metal due to its HSH pickup configuration, locking tremolo bridge, and fast-playing neck, which offer the aggressive tones and stability needed for metal styles.

What is the neck profile like on the Ibanez SRG450QMZD Standard?

The Ibanez SRG450QMZD Standard features a slim and fast-playing neck profile, making it ideal for players who prioritize speed and comfort, particularly in genres like rock and metal.

Does the Ibanez SRG450QMZD Standard have a locking tremolo system?

Yes, the Ibanez SRG450QMZD Standard is equipped with a locking tremolo bridge, allowing for stable tuning even during heavy tremolo use and dive-bomb effects.

What materials are used in the construction of the Ibanez SRG450QMZD Standard?

The Ibanez SRG450QMZD Standard features a basswood body with a quilted maple top, a maple neck, and a rosewood fretboard, combining to create a balanced tone with a visually striking appearance.
